Coverage of both process and design failure analysis makes this book invaluble for those working in quality assurance, design engineering, metallurgy, and materials. Users learn to identify sources of failures and defects--investigate and test areas of failure--and implement remedial measures for corrosion, overload, fatigue, and wear. Included are 36 case studies that cover heat deterioration, cracking, shear, high-velocity impact, torsional and bending overload, creep, and other phenomena.

Complete Investigative Toolkit for Metal Failure-Design or Process
Whether the problem is corrosion on the working surfaces of valuable or life-essential machinery, breakdowns in linchpin equipment, or life-threatening faults in air- or spacecraft, the causes must be found so that future disasters may be prevented. Metallurgy of Failure Analysis puts the tools for finding the answers in your hands.
A complete guide to all types of metal failure, both design and process, it features: coverage of faults due to casting, forging, welding, machining, and heat treatment; analysis of the concepts and mechanisms of fatigue, stress corrosion, hydrogen embrittlement, and more; remedial measure for corrosion, overload, fatigue, and wear; investigative procedures including destructive, nondestructive, and fractographic analysis.
